Output 86446056c23dc100c4f139b6422e52fcbf0a067ad4022d94ac6f6e7004f92367:52

value
293622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0615d754ab67d4fba71572840e5befd37d28927a OP_EQUAL
address
32FC9F5Daa64A2fAzj5mWAp4vd55onYb9q
transaction
86446056c23dc100c4f139b6422e52fcbf0a067ad4022d94ac6f6e7004f92367
spent
true